Output 89b458249cee3060d73b5864db654c3dcb16f32e7192c42f089e8f57bf5be25b:1

value
15807371
script pubkey
OP_0 OP_PUSHBYTES_20 5f755807a49b9c451d09d17064f5c474be233e47
address
ltc1qta64spaynwwy28gf69cxfawywjlzx0j8a0e457
transaction
89b458249cee3060d73b5864db654c3dcb16f32e7192c42f089e8f57bf5be25b
spent
true